# StyleMCP Executable brand rules for AI models and agents. Keep every AI-generated message on-brand. ## What is StyleMCP? StyleMCP validates and rewrites AI-generated text to match your brand voice. Use it as: - **REST API** - Validate text from any application - **MCP Server** - Direct integration with Claude and other AI agents - **CLI** - Check copy in your terminal or CI/CD - **GitHub Action** - Catch off-brand copy in pull requests ## Quick Start ### API ```bash curl -X POST https://stylemcp.com/api/validate \ -H "Content-Type: application/json" \ -d '{"text": "Click here to learn more!"}' ``` Response: ```json { "valid": false, "score": 65, "violations": [ { "rule": "no-click-here", "severity": "error", "message": "Avoid 'click here' - describe the destination instead", "suggestion": "Learn more about our features" } ] } ``` ### CLI ```bash # Install npm install -g stylemcp # Validate text stylemcp validate "Click here to learn more" # Validate file stylemcp validate src/copy/homepage.json --pack saas # Rewrite text stylemcp rewrite "Please utilize our product" --mode aggressive ``` ### MCP (Claude Desktop) Add to your `claude_desktop_config.json`: ```json { "mcpServers": { "stylemcp": { "command": "npx", "args": ["stylemcp"] } } } ``` Now Claude can validate and rewrite text using your brand rules. ## API Endpoints | Method | Endpoint | Description | |--------|----------|-------------| | POST | `/api/validate` | Validate text against brand rules | | POST | `/api/rewrite` | Rewrite text to match brand voice | | POST | `/api/validate/batch` | Validate multiple texts | | GET | `/api/packs` | List available style packs | | GET | `/api/packs/{pack}/voice` | Get voice guidelines | | GET | `/api/packs/{pack}/ctas` | Get CTA rules | | GET | `/api/mcp/sse` | MCP SSE endpoint | | POST | `/api/mcp/call` | MCP tool calls | ## Style Packs StyleMCP uses **style packs** - YAML files that define your brand rules. ### Available Packs | Pack | Best For | Key Features | |------|----------|--------------| | `saas` | B2B SaaS products | Professional, clear, helpful tone | | `ecommerce` | DTC & retail brands | Friendly, conversion-focused, no pushy CTAs | | `healthcare` | Medical & wellness | Compliant language, no cure claims, person-first | | `finance` | Fintech & banking | Precise, risk-aware, no guaranteed returns | ### Example: `saas` Pack - **Vocabulary**: Prefer "use" over "utilize", "help" over "assist" - **Forbidden words**: "synergy", "leverage", "cutting-edge", "game-changing" - **Patterns to avoid**: "click here", "we're sorry for any inconvenience" - **CTA rules**: Avoid "Submit", "Click here", "OK" - prefer "Save", "Create", "Sign up" ### Pack Structure ``` packs/ my-brand/ manifest.yaml # Pack metadata voice.yaml # Tone, vocabulary, forbidden words copy_patterns.yaml # Reusable copy templates cta_rules.yaml # Button/CTA guidelines tokens.json # Design tokens (optional) ``` ### Create Your Own Pack ```bash # Copy the default pack cp -r packs/saas packs/my-brand # Edit the rules nano packs/my-brand/voice.yaml # Use your pack curl -X POST https://stylemcp.com/api/validate \ -d '{"text": "Your text", "pack": "my-brand"}' ``` ### voice.yaml Example ```yaml tone: summary: "Friendly, clear, and helpful" attributes: - name: friendly weight: 0.8 - name: professional weight: 0.7 vocabulary: rules: - preferred: "use" avoid: ["utilize", "leverage"] - preferred: "help" avoid: ["assist", "facilitate"] forbidden: - "synergy" - "paradigm shift" - "game-changing" doNot: - pattern: "click here" reason: "Poor accessibility" suggestion: "Describe the destination" severity: error - pattern: "\\b(obviously|simply|just)\\b" isRegex: true reason: "Can make users feel stupid" severity: warning ``` ## Self-Hosting ### Docker ```bash # Clone the repo git clone https://github.com/3DUNLMTD/stylemcp.git cd stylemcp # Set up environment echo "STYLEMCP_API_KEY=$(openssl rand -hex 32)" > .env # Run with Docker docker compose up -d # Check health curl http://localhost:3000/health ``` ### Manual ```bash # Install dependencies npm install # Build npm run build # Start server npm start ``` ## GitHub Actions ```yaml name: Brand Check on: [pull_request] jobs: validate: runs-on: ubuntu-latest steps: - uses: actions/checkout@v4 - name: Validate copy run: | npx stylemcp validate src/copy/*.json \ --min-score 80 \ --format github ``` ## Environment Variables | Variable | Description | Default | |----------|-------------|---------| | `PORT` | Server port | 3000 | | `STYLEMCP_API_KEY` | API key for authentication | (none) | | `GITHUB_WEBHOOK_SECRET` | GitHub webhook secret | (none) | ## MCP Tools When used as an MCP server, StyleMCP provides these tools: | Tool | Description | |------|-------------| | `validate_text` | Validate text against brand rules | | `rewrite_to_style` | Rewrite text to match brand voice | | `get_voice_rules` | Get voice and tone guidelines | | `get_copy_patterns` | Get approved copy patterns | | `get_cta_rules` | Get CTA guidelines | | `get_tokens` | Get design tokens | | `list_packs` | List available style packs | ## What Gets Validated? The `saas` pack checks for: ### Vocabulary - Use simple words: "use" not "utilize", "help" not "assist" - Avoid jargon: "synergy", "leverage", "paradigm shift" - Avoid weak intensifiers: "very", "really", "extremely" ### Patterns - No "click here" (accessibility issue) - No "we're sorry for any inconvenience" (corporate non-apology) - No double "please" (sounds desperate) - No starting with "Sorry" (lead with solutions) ### CTAs - Avoid generic: "Submit", "OK", "Yes/No", "Click here" - Use specific actions: "Save", "Create", "Sign up", "Export" - Max 4 words ### Constraints - Max 25 words per sentence - No exclamation marks (in most contexts) - First-person plural ("we", "our") - Oxford comma ## License MIT
